Innovator Growth-100 Power Buffer ETF - March
The Innovator Growth-100 Power Buffer ETF - March (NMAR) is a distinctive investment vehicle designed for those seeking a strategic approach to managing market volatility within the large-cap sector. This ETF is part of the Size and Style category, focusing on large-cap stocks within a broad-based niche, specifically targeting the NASDAQ 100 index. NMAR offers investors a unique opportunity to participate in the growth potential of some of the most robust and influential companies, while simultaneously providing a level of downside protection through its innovative buffer strategy.
The fund employs an actively managed structure, utilizing a combination of options and collateral to achieve its investment objectives. This approach allows NMAR to aim for specific buffered losses—cushioning investors against significant downturns—while also setting a cap on potential gains over a defined holding period. By aligning with the NASDAQ 100, the ETF taps into a diverse array of sectors, including technology, healthcare, and consumer services, offering exposure to industry leaders and innovators.
NMAR is particularly suited for investors who are looking to balance risk and reward, seeking both capital appreciation and a measure of protection against adverse market movements. Its tactical use of options distinguishes it from traditional index-tracking ETFs, making it an appealing choice for those who want to navigate the complexities of large-cap investing with a tailored risk management strategy.
